What is an HHC disposable vape?
An HHC disposable vape is a compact, single-use device pre-filled with an HHC-containing liquid. There’s no assembly, charging or refilling needed—open the box and it’s ready to use. Disposables are popular with first-time buyers who want convenience, and with experienced users who value portability and low maintenance.

Unlike refillable pens or 510-thread cartridges, a disposable is an all-in-one unit. When it reaches the end of its lifespan, you replace the device instead of swapping a cartridge. Disposable vs cartridge: which should you pick?
Choose a disposable HHC vape if you want:
- Zero setup: no batteries or chargers to purchase.
- Pocket-friendly form factor: small, discreet, travel-ready.
- Predictable experience per device: each unit is factory-set.
Consider a 510-thread HHC cartridge + pen if you prefer:
- Reusability: keep the battery/pen, replace only the cartridge.
- More control: variable voltage/wattage on some pens.
- Accessory ecosystem: cases, chargers and formats to mix and match.

How to choose the right HHC disposable
Use this quick checklist to narrow your choice:
- Capacity (ml)
Common sizes are 1 ml or 2 ml. More liquid typically means more puffs—handy if you want fewer replacements. - Coil & airflow
Look for modern mesh coils and smooth airflow; these features contribute to consistent vapour production and flavour. - Flavour profile
If you’re new, start with classic profiles (e.g., OG, Gelato, Sour) or neutral flavours. If flavour matters most, check customer feedback on taste notes. - Batch transparency
Prefer brands with public batch PDFs that include methodology (e.g., HPLC) and clear batch numbers you can match to the package label. - Build & safety details
A good disposable lists manufacture date, storage guidelines and support contact details. Devices should come with basic handling instructions. - Price vs longevity
A larger capacity disposable can be better value than multiple smaller units. Compare ml per € and check any bundle savings.

How is a disposable different from a 510-thread cartridge?
A disposable is all-in-one; a cartridge is a separate 510-thread tank you use with a compatible vape pen battery. Cartridges are replaceable; disposables are replaced as a whole unit.
